Could be a genuine trade buyer

However
More likely a "travelling" business hoping the girl
wouldn't know the true value of the Land Rover.

She's probably lucky they didn't steal it and just left a card.

"N Price 4x4" doesn't seem to exist, certainly not as a registered business. Unless he's just doing it as a sideline.
You're allowed to buy and sell six vehicles per year before it has to be classed as a business.
